1. #cadillac Fleetwood 75: This car was first introduced in the 1930s and was known for its massive size. It had a length of over 21 feet and a weight of over 5,000 pounds. It was powered by a V8 engine and had a top speed of over 90 miles per hour. It was used as a limousine by many presidents and dignitaries, making it a popular choice for those looking for a spacious and luxurious vehicle.
2. #lincoln Continental: This luxury car was first introduced in the 1940s and was known for its massive size and powerful V8 engine. It had a length of over 18 feet and a weight of over 4,500 pounds. It was a popular choice among the wealthy and was often used as a presidential limousine by many U.S. presidents, including John F. Kennedy.
3. #buick Roadmaster: This car was first introduced in the 1940s and was known for its massive size and powerful V8 engine. It had a length of over 18 feet and a weight of over 4,500 pounds. It was a popular car among families and had plenty of room for passengers and luggage.
